- 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:Excel 改ページ設定マクロ)
Excel 改ページ設定マクロ
このQ&Aのポイント
- Excelで改ページを設定するマクロの書き方を教えてください。
- Excelの印刷範囲を設定する方法を教えてください。
- Excelの改ページ設定を使って空行の上まで印刷を止める方法を教えてください。
- みんなの回答 (1)
- 専門家の回答
質問者が選んだベストアンサー
こんにちは。 以下のようにしてください。 With ActiveSheet 'maxR = .Range("A" & Rows.Count).End(xlUp).Row maxR = .Range("A1").End(xlDown).Row For wR = 4 To maxR If .Cells(wR, 5).Value <> Cells(wR - 1, 5) Then '日付が変わる時、改頁の Break Point設定 .Rows(wR).PageBreak = xlPageBreakManual End If Next End With With ActiveSheet.PageSetup .PrintTitleRows = "$1:$2" '←2行見出し .PrintArea = "A1:H" & maxR '←印刷範囲設定 End With
お礼
pkh4989さん ありがとうございました。 巧くいきました。